Evaluation of the Effectiveness of the Project Team in the Field of Digital Marketing Based on KPIs in MTS PJSC

Student: Khalif Egor

Supervisor: Ulyana Podverbnykh

Faculty: Graduate School of Business

Educational Programme: Business Administration (Bachelor)

Year of Graduation: 2021

In the modern world of business, in the conditions of fierce competition, where various factors and the speed of decision-making play a significant role, the concept of KPI, introduced into the management of enterprises, has gained its huge popularity. Today, companies use a system of key indicators to evaluate project teams in digital marketing. Managers need specific indicators used in the management process. The combination of these indicators is always individual, their number and content are unique and depend on the strategy of the organization. However, managers incorrectly define key indicators or incorrectly use the KPI system. This study examines the problem areas in the KPI system, which is implemented in the project team of the CSM MTS in the field of digital marketing. Qualitative and quantitative methods (in-depth interviews and online surveys) will be used to conduct the research. Also, content analysis, swot analysis, system analysis. The results of the study can practically help marketers/teams/project managers to develop and implement a KPI system in project teams in the field of DM for a more comprehensive understanding of the importance of using a KPI system.
